Aimee is committed to:
* Advocating for a future for Oakland's  youth: resources for excellent 
schools and after school programs, and job  and college placement opportunties;
* Creating economic development that lasts: balancing housing and  industrial 
growth to create real economic development;
* Developing  affordable housing for working families: mandating the creation 
of  affordable homes to help all Oakland residents;
* Making Oakland safer for all: demanding a responsive, accountable  police 
force, directing resources to addressing violent crime, and  implementing 
programs to address the root causes of violence in our  community.
